  • Publication number: 20230247062
    Abstract: A malware neutralization system for a computer network includes an intrusion detection system (IDS) in data communications with the computer network. The IDS is arranged to: i) detect malware communications between a malware command and control (C2) server and a malware client on a computer connected to the computer network and ii) send a malware alert to a malware response server. The malware response server is in communications with the computer network and arranged to: i) receive the first malware alert, ii) determine the type of malware threat based on the first malware alert, iii) intercept one or more malware messages from the malware client that are directed to the malware C2 server, iv) instantiate an appropriate malware response module, and v) use the loaded response module to send one or more malware response messages to the malware client to disrupt an operation of the malware client.

  • Publication number: 20150176142
    Abstract: An electrolysis cell assembly to produce diluted Sodium Hydroxide solutions NaOH and diluted Hypochlorous Acid HOCl solutions having cleaning and sanitizing properties. The electrolysis cell consists of two insulating end pieces for a cylindrical electrolysis cell comprising at least two cylindrical electrodes with two cylindrical ion selective membranes arranged co-axially between them. The method of producing different volumes and concentrations of diluted NaOH solutions and diluted HOCl solutions comprises recirculating an aqueous sodium chloride or potassium chloride solution into the middle chamber of the cylindrical electrolytic cell and feeding softened filtered water into the cathode chamber and into the anode chamber of the cylindrical electrolysis cell.

  • Patent number: 4948605
    Abstract: An assembly for packaging a frozen food is adapted to be exposed to microwave energy such that the frozen food is processed and, in particular, defrosted efficiently from its solid to its liquid state. The assembly includes a container normally disposed on the bottom, and a cover normally disposed on the top of the assembly and adapted to be releasably engaged with the container to form the assembly. When assembled, the cover and container support in a generally upright orientation the frozen food. The cover includes means for supporting only a top portion of the frozen food, while exposing the bottom portion of the frozen food directly to microwave energy.
